An exciting opportunity exists for an enthusiastic and experienced Allied Health Assistant to work in our Community Care Program.

Our Allied Health Assistants work within a multidisciplinary allied health team, providing support across all disciplines, however the role is primarily focused on supporting Occupational Therapy and Physiotherapy clients.

The target population includes people with, or at risk of, chronic conditions, people with multiple and complex needs and those from culturally and linguistically diverse backgrounds.


Ideally, you will possess:


  • A professional qualification
  • Certificate IV in Allied Health Assisting from an accredited Registered Training Organization/RTO or equivalent qualification
  • Experience working as an Allied Health Assistant or in a related area, including supervising exercise groups and handling aids and
equipment.

  • Demonstrated ability to working within a team and autonomously to support clients from diverse backgrounds, and with multiple and complex needs.
  • Excellent knowledge and experience of working in the aged and community sector ,preferably in a Community Health setting.
  • A clear understanding of and a commitment to the Social Model of Health and Community Health Philosophy.

What makes BHN Tick?
**Better Health Network (BHN) encompasses more than 22 locations and has over 800 staff work in multi-disciplinary teams to deliver health and disability outcomes. BHN is a responsive and agile community health service, providing a wide range of healthcare, social support, disability, and welfare services for all members of the community.
BHN provides services spanning all periods of life including specialist childhood, youth, and aged care services.

In achieving its vision of health and wellbeing for all, BHN is guided by our distinct service principles which include working with people and communities to achieve their health goals, understanding the context in which people live their lives, providing friendly, affordable, and holistic service.
